MATTER OF VECCHIO v. DEL VECCHIO


11 A.D.2d 574 (1960)

In the Matter of the Claim of Anthony Del Vecchio, Respondent, v. Peter Del Vecchio et al., Respondents, and New Amsterdam Casualty Company, Appellant. Workmen's Compensation Board, Respondent

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, Third Department.

May 16, 1960


Peter and Mary Del Vecchio owned a building at 371-377 Smith Street, City of Rochester, New York. In 1941 they started a business known as "Mary's Linen Shop" in part of the building and took out workmen's compensation insurance coverage. In 1945 the remainder of the building was occupied when they started a new business known as "Dell's Appliance Store".
